Named by [[Gene Ward Smith]] in 2011<ref>[https://yahootuninggroupsultimatebackup.github.io/tuning-math/topicId_18891.html Yahoo! Tuning Group | ''Progression temperament'']</ref>, progression can be described as the {{nowrap| 8d & 9 }} temperament. It has a generator that is a somewhat flat neutral second, three make [[5/4]], five make [[3/2]], and seven make [[7/4]], with a [[ploidacot]] signature of pentacot. [[17edo]] is an obvious tuning for it. | |||

Subklei is likely named for its flatter minor third generator than [[kleismic]]. It tempers out [[1029/1000]] as well as [[2401/2400]] and can be described as {{nowrap| 17c & 21 }}. Its [[ploidacot]] is delta-hexacot. Note that in the data below, the generator is the [[5/3]][[~]][[12/7]] major sixth, so that six generators minus four octaves give the [[3/2|perfect fifth]]. | |||

Slurpee may be described as the {{nowrap| 16 & 17c }} temperament. It has a generator that is a somewhat flat semitone of [[~]][[21/20]], three make [[8/7]], seven make [[4/3]], and eleven make [[8/5]], with a [[ploidacot]] signature of omega-heptacot. | |||
